Transaction 2f918dc2c058c3a75d11f7cf04c9d588c15f4980e3f8ea164e5ae30d23ddb138

1 Input
1 Outputs
  • 2f918dc2c058c3a75d11f7cf04c9d588c15f4980e3f8ea164e5ae30d23ddb138:0
  • value  3788643
    address  3PuJqAGgwGhL1ohZhk3uJjss7c6xnEU3da